华为手机使用ADB时为何不单独提供USB驱动?

8次阅读
没有评论

问题描述

使用MyPhoneExplorer等应用与华为手机进行USB同步时,需要安装手机的USB驱动和ADB应用。然而,华为官方提供的驱动似乎仅作为HiSuite软件的一部分提供。因此,用户只能选择安装HiSuite软件以获取所需的USB驱动,或者寻找可能携带病毒的非官方驱动。

解决方案

方案1:安装HiSuite获取驱动

请注意,安装HiSuite可能会带来隐私风险,建议安装后立即卸载HiSuite以保留驱动程序。
根据多位用户的反馈,华为官方并未单独提供USB驱动,而是将其与HiSuite捆绑在一起。可以通过安装HiSuite来获取所需的USB驱动。具体步骤如下:

  1. 下载并安装HiSuite。
  2. 安装完成后,重启电脑。
  3. 不要使用HiSuite进行任何操作,直接卸载HiSuite。
  4. 卸载HiSuite后,USB驱动会保留在系统中,可以直接使用。

方案2:提取HiSuite安装包中的驱动

提取安装包中的驱动可能需要一定的技术知识。
另一种方法是直接从HiSuite安装包中提取USB驱动,避免安装不必要的软件。具体步骤如下:

  1. 下载HiSuite安装包。
  2. 使用7-Zip等工具解压安装包,保持内部文件夹结构不变。
  3. 在解压后的文件夹中找到类似DriverSetup.exe的文件。
  4. 在安全的虚拟机或临时环境中运行并安装该驱动。

方案3:启用开发者模式

适用于部分华为手机型号。
对于某些华为手机型号,可以通过启用开发者模式来直接访问手机存储空间,而无需安装额外的驱动或软件。具体步骤如下:

  1. 进入手机“设置” > “关于手机”。
  2. 连续点击“构建号”七次,直到看到“您现在是开发者!”的消息。
  3. 返回“设置”,进入“开发者选项”。
  4. 打开“USB配置”,选择MTP或PTP模式。
  5. 连接手机到电脑,使用Windows资源管理器访问手机存储。

方案4:使用Google提供的ADB工具

适用于已经安装了Google USB驱动的用户。
如果您的电脑上已经安装了Google USB驱动,可以直接使用ADB工具与华为手机进行通信。具体步骤如下:

  1. 下载并安装Android SDK平台工具。
  2. 找到platform-tools目录下的adb工具。
  3. 使用adb devices命令检查设备是否被识别。
  4. 如果未识别,请按照上述方法安装华为手机的USB驱动。

以上方案中,方案1是最简单直接的方法,但可能涉及隐私风险;方案2和方案3提供了更灵活的选择,但需要一定的技术操作;方案4适用于已经安装了Google USB驱动的用户。

正文完